    Distant monitoring without proxy

    Hello,
    I want to monitor computers via the web and I can not understand how to do without using a proxy just with zabbix agent on a windowsXP machine?

    can you help me?

    thank you

    ps: My project is to monitor the computer park of several different customers located in geographically dispersed locations (multiple routers).
    I want to use zabbix agent alone, rather than the solution nodes.

    if the network works ok between zabbix server and monitored devices, you just do it the same way as you would for local servers, you just have to decide what protocols you want to monitor and figure out whether you will have any firewall issues

      thanks

      i have success by using zabbix agent (actif) but i don't sure i have do the good way for add my host

      if my host is distant and his ip unknown or private (local), how i can receive the info of the agent ?

      what ip choose when we attend informations by the agent ?

        if agent can connect to the server, use active items. if server can connect to the agent, use passive items. if neither can connect to the other one - quite obviously, you have to figure something out (nat, port forwarding, tunneling...)

          yes, but in zabbix configuration, how the server know the host ?

          if i create a host with just the same name than in zabbix-agent, without ip or dns, server know the host ?

            if you use passive checks, you must configure ip.
            if you use active checks, yes, matching hostname in agentd config file and zabbix frontend will work (provided agent can connect to the server)
